Welcome, wanderers and dreamers, to an enchanting journey through the charming city of Newbury in Berkshire, United Kingdom. Here, amid the picturesque countryside and historic landmarks, lies a collection of hotels that promise to sweep you off your feet and transport you to a world of pure romance. Step into a realm where love blossoms like the vibrant flowers in a lush garden, where every moment is filled with passion and allure. These hidden gems offer an unparalleled experience for those seeking to reconnect, reignite, or simply revel in the magic of love.
Let your senses be tantalized by the luxurious accommodations, exquisite dining options, and impeccable service that await you at our handpicked selection of romantic hotels in Newbury. Each property is a testament to elegance and sophistication, where every detail has been meticulously curated to create an atmosphere of pure bliss and intimacy. As you bask in the opulent surroundings and indulge in decadent treats, you will feel as though you have stepped into a fairytale where time stands still and love reigns supreme.
Unwind in the lavish suites adorned with plush furnishings and breathtaking views, or savor a candlelit dinner under the starlit sky at a cozy onsite restaurant. Whether you choose to explore the city hand in hand, relax in a private spa retreat, or simply cozy up by the fireplace with a glass of champagne, our romantic hotels in Newbury offer the perfect setting for a truly unforgettable experience. So come, let us guide you on a journey of passion, romance, and unforgettable memories that will leave you spellbound and longing for more.